    Field Marshal Asim Munir hails Pakistan, China military ties at PLA’s 99th anniversary

    RAWALPINDI: Pakistan’s Chief of Defence Forces Field Marshal Syed Asim Munir highlighted the strong defence partnership between Pakistan and China, saying the two countries armed forces remain committed to mutual trust, cooperation and shared strategic interests during a ceremony marking the 99th anniversary of China’s People’s Liberation Army (PLA).

    The event was held at General Headquarters (GHQ) in Rawalpindi, where senior military officials, Chinese diplomats and representatives from both countries attended the ceremony, according to Pakistan’s Inter Services Public Relations (ISPR).

    Chinese Ambassador to Pakistan Jiang Zaidong attended the ceremony as the chief guest, along with China’s Defence Attache Major General Wang Zhong, officials from the Chinese Embassy and senior officers from Pakistan’s army, navy and air force.

    Field Marshal Munir welcomed the Chinese delegation and congratulated the PLA on completing 99 years since its establishment. He praised the Chinese military’s role in strengthening China’s defence capabilities, supporting national development and contributing to international peace and security.

    Addressing the gathering, Munir described Pakistan, China relations as a unique and long standing friendship that has remained strong despite changes in regional and global conditions.

    He said Pakistan’s armed forces and the PLA are “true partners” whose relationship is based on mutual confidence, continued support and cooperation to promote peace and stability in the region.

    Munir also reaffirmed Pakistan’s commitment to further expanding military cooperation with China, by saying both countries share common strategic interests and remain dedicated to maintaining regional security.

    Chinese Ambassador Jiang Zaidong thanked Field Marshal Munir for hosting the ceremony and appreciated the efforts and sacrifices of Pakistan’s armed forces in combating terrorism.

    Jiang also reiterated China’s continued support for Pakistan and expressed Beijing’s commitment to strengthening the two countries all weather strategic cooperative partnership.

    The ceremony reflected the longstanding defence ties between Pakistan and China, which have expanded through military cooperation, joint training exercises and strategic coordination over several decades.

    Both sides emphasized the importance of continued collaboration to address regional security challenges and promote peace through stronger bilateral relations. The PLA was established on Aug. 1, 1927, and has since become a key institution of China’s national defence system.
